[`Cell`] or [`RefCell`] types. //! +//! ## Naming threads +//! +//! Threads are able to have associated names for identification purposes. By default, spawned +//! threads are unnamed. To specify a name for a thread, build the thread with [`Builder`] and pass +//! the desired thread name to [`Builder::name`]. To retrieve the thread name from within the +//! thread, use [`Thread::name`]. A couple examples of where the name of a thread gets used: +//! +//! * If a panic occurs in a named thread, the thread name will be printed in the panic message. +//! * The thread name is provided to the OS where applicable (e.g. `pthread_setname_np` in +//! unix-like platforms). +//! +//! ## Stack size +//! +//! The default stack size for spawned threads is 2 MiB, though this particular stack size is +//! subject to change in the future. There are two ways to manually specify the stack size for +//! spawned threads: +//! +//! * Build the thread with [`Builder`] and pass the desired stack size to [`Builder::stack_size`]. +//! * Set the `RUST_MIN_STACK` environment variable to an integer representing the desired stack +//! size (in bytes). Note that setting [`Builder::stack_size`] will override this. +//! +//! Note that the stack size of the main thread is *not* determined by Rust. +//! //!
